[QUOTE="happy harry, post: 272994, member: 13002"] [COLOR=blue]But a supervisor can advise him on what he has to do,and what qualifications he will need.He could maybe try to help this employee through the ranks. I understand that it is seniority based, but that was why i adressed the fact that is easier than years ago because most of the time when the most senior employees are called they lack the necessary qualifications needed.[/COLOR] [COLOR=#0000ff]Also you don't necessarily have to be a union employee to become a driver. They take management employees as well after all contractual obligations are exhausted.[/COLOR] [/QUOTE]
